[0041] forward simulation
[0042] Such as figure 1 As shown, it is a physical model of a double-layer medium. The upper medium is a uniform medium with a velocity of 1500m / s, and the surrounding rock velocity of the lower medium is 2300m / s. Relatively low velocity (1800m / s, 1900m / s, 2000m / s s, 2100m / s), caves and cracks of different sizes and shapes.
